Q: Is 52,343,755 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 52,343,755 is a composite number.

Why is 52,343,755 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 52,343,755 can be evenly divided by 1 5 101 505 103,651 518,255 10,468,751 and 52,343,755, with no remainder.

Since 52,343,755 cannot be divided by just 1 and 52,343,755, it is a composite number.
